What is shopping campaign management with Claude AI?

Shopping campaign management with Claude AI means connecting Anthropic's Claude to your Google Shopping campaigns so it can analyze product performance, optimize bids, audit feed quality, and identify growth opportunities without manual data exports. Unlike Search campaigns that target keywords, Shopping campaigns rely on product feeds, competitive pricing analysis, and product group structuring — all data-intensive tasks where how to manage shopping campaigns with Claude AI becomes invaluable for e-commerce advertisers.

The automation works through real-time API connections or scheduled data imports. Claude analyzes product-level metrics like cost-per-click, conversion rates, impression share, and search term performance. It identifies underperforming product groups, suggests bid adjustments, flags feed issues causing disapprovals, and recommends negative keywords. How do you connect Claude to Shopping campaigns?

There are three primary methods to get Shopping campaign data into Claude, each with different tradeoffs between setup complexity, data freshness, and automation capabilities. Your choice depends on technical comfort level, frequency of optimization needs, and whether you want real-time or periodic analysis.

Connection MethodSetup TimeData FreshnessBest For
Ryze MCP ConnectorUnder 3 minutesReal-time via Google Ads APIDaily optimization & monitoring
CSV Export Method0 minutes (immediate)Static snapshotWeekly audits & deep-dives
Google Sheets Integration10-15 minutesAuto-refresh (hourly/daily)Scheduled reporting

CSV Export Method: In Google Ads, navigate to Shopping campaigns > Products > Download report. Select metrics: Clicks, Impressions, Cost, Conversions, Conv. value, CTR, CPC, Conv. rate, Cost/conv., Product title, Product type. Upload the CSV to a Claude Project and start analysis immediately. While data is static, this method works for comprehensive audits and one-off optimizations.

Google Sheets Integration: Create a Google Ads report that auto-refreshes into Google Sheets using the Google Ads add-on. Share the sheet with Claude MCP or export as CSV periodically. This semi-automated approach balances data freshness with setup simplicity. For detailed instructions, see our step-by-step Google Ads connection guide.

What are the 6 Shopping campaign workflows you can automate?

These workflows transform how to manage shopping campaigns with Claude AI from reactive troubleshooting to proactive optimization. Each addresses a specific challenge that costs e-commerce advertisers 15-30% of their potential revenue when managed manually. Product feed errors alone cause 25% of Shopping ads to be disapproved or show for irrelevant searches.

Workflow 01

Product Performance Analysis

Shopping campaigns often have 10-15% of products generating 70-80% of conversions while hundreds of other products drain budget with minimal returns. Claude analyzes conversion rates, ROAS, and click-through rates at the product level, identifying top performers and budget wasters. It calculates statistical significance for performance differences and recommends bid adjustments or product group restructuring. This workflow typically recovers 20-35% of wasted ad spend.

Example promptAnalyze my Shopping campaign product performance for the last 30 days. Identify products with ROAS > 4.0x (winners), ROAS < 1.5x (losers), and products spending $200+ with 0 conversions. Calculate total wasted spend and recommend bid adjustments for each category.

Workflow 02

Search Term Mining & Negative Keywords

Shopping campaigns trigger on search queries based on product titles, descriptions, and Google's understanding of your products. This leads to irrelevant traffic — searches for "free," "cheap," "wholesale," competitor brand names, or completely unrelated products. Claude analyzes search term reports, categorizes queries by relevance and intent, calculates cost-per-click for non-converting terms, and generates negative keyword lists. This typically reduces wasted spend by 15-25%.

Example promptReview my Shopping search terms from the last 14 days. Flag terms with: - 0 conversions and >$50 spend - Clear irrelevant intent (free, cheap, competitor names) - Brand mismatch queries Generate negative keyword lists by match type and estimate savings.

Workflow 03

Product Feed Quality Audit

Google disapproves 20-40% of Shopping ads due to feed issues: missing required attributes, policy violations, incorrect pricing, poor image quality, or mismatched landing pages. Claude analyzes your product feed structure, identifies missing or inconsistent data, flags potential policy violations, and prioritizes fixes by revenue impact. It checks for common issues like missing GTINs, vague product titles, missing product categories, and price discrepancies between feed and website.

Example promptAudit my Shopping product feed for quality issues. Check for: - Missing required attributes (GTIN, brand, condition) - Inconsistent product titles and descriptions - Price mismatches between feed and landing pages - Products disapproved in the last 30 days Prioritize fixes by revenue potential.

Workflow 04

Competitive Price Monitoring

Shopping ads show price comparison directly in search results. Products priced 15-20% above competitors often see 40-60% lower click-through rates. Claude analyzes auction insights, identifies products losing impression share to competitors, correlates performance drops with pricing position, and recommends strategic price adjustments. It distinguishes between temporary promotional pricing and sustainable competitive positioning to avoid margin erosion.

Example promptAnalyze competitive pricing impact on my Shopping campaigns. Identify products with declining impression share, low CTR relative to category benchmarks, and strong conversion rates but poor visibility. Calculate revenue impact of 5-15% price adjustments for key products.

Workflow 05

Seasonal Performance Optimization

E-commerce brands see 200-500% conversion rate swings between peak seasons (Black Friday, Christmas) and slow periods (January, summer). Claude analyzes year-over-year trends, identifies seasonal patterns by product category, recommends budget allocation shifts, and suggests promotional timing. It accounts for inventory levels, lead times, and profit margins to optimize both revenue and cash flow during seasonal peaks.

Example promptReview seasonal trends in my Shopping campaigns over the last 12 months. Identify products with strong Q4 performance, compare current metrics to last year's baseline, and recommend budget allocation for upcoming holiday season. Factor in current inventory levels.

Workflow 06

Cross-Campaign Performance Reporting

Most brands run multiple Shopping campaigns (by product category, target ROAS, geographic region) making performance tracking complex. Manual reporting takes 3-4 hours weekly across campaigns, product groups, and individual SKUs. Claude generates executive dashboards showing campaign-level ROAS, product category performance, geographic breakdowns, and month-over-month trends. It flags anomalies, identifies growth opportunities, and provides 3-5 specific action items for the coming week.

Example promptGenerate a comprehensive Shopping campaigns report for March 2026. Include: campaign-level ROAS, top/bottom performing product categories, geographic performance breakdown, week-over-week trends, and 5 action items for April optimization. Format for executive presentation.

How does Claude optimize product feed quality?

Product feed optimization is critical because Google's algorithm relies entirely on feed data to determine when and where your Shopping ads appear. Poor feed quality causes ads to show for irrelevant searches, triggers disapprovals, and reduces impression share. Google's research shows that optimized product feeds improve Shopping campaign performance by 25-40% on average.

Claude analyzes your feed across five dimensions: Completeness (missing attributes like GTIN, brand, product_type), Accuracy (price mismatches, broken links, incorrect availability), Consistency (naming conventions, category structure), Relevance (search-friendly titles and descriptions), and Compliance (Google Shopping policies). It prioritizes fixes by revenue impact — products with high search volume or strong conversion history get priority.

For feed optimization, Claude examines product title effectiveness by analyzing search term performance. Titles with specific brand names, model numbers, and key features typically achieve 30-50% higher CTRs than generic descriptions. It recommends title rewrites based on actual search queries driving conversions, ensures descriptions include relevant keywords without stuffing, and flags products missing critical attributes that limit visibility.

Advanced feed optimization includes competitive analysis where Claude compares your product information against top-ranking competitors for the same items. It identifies gaps in product details, suggests additional attributes that competitors include, and recommends image quality improvements based on Shopping ad performance data. This level of analysis traditionally requires dedicated feed management tools costing $200-500/month.

What automated performance monitoring can Claude provide?

Automated performance monitoring transforms reactive Shopping campaign management into proactive optimization. Claude continuously tracks key performance indicators and alerts you to changes that require immediate attention: ROAS drops below target thresholds, impression share losses to competitors, sudden spikes in cost-per-click, or conversion rate declines by product category.

The monitoring system works through statistical anomaly detection. Claude establishes baseline performance ranges for each metric based on 30-90 days of historical data, then flags deviations that exceed two standard deviations from the mean. This approach eliminates false alarms from normal day-to-day fluctuations while catching genuine performance issues within 24-48 hours of occurrence.

Weekly performance summaries include trending analysis across product categories, geographic regions, and device types. Claude identifies which products are gaining or losing market share, correlates performance changes with external factors (seasonality, competitors, inventory levels), and forecasts next month's performance based on current trends. This predictive capability helps with budget planning and inventory management.

For multi-campaign setups, Claude provides cross-campaign performance attribution. It identifies product categories that perform better in specific campaign types (Standard Shopping vs. Performance Max), recommends budget shifts between campaigns, and flags cannibalization where multiple campaigns compete for the same searches. This analysis prevents wasted spend from internal competition between your own campaigns.
